What is the federal income tax?
The federal income tax is one of the main tax categories in the United States, which is directly levied by the IRS over the annual taxable income of individuals and legal entities. It also constitutes the largest revenue source of the US government.
What is a federal tax return and why is it important for my US company?
A federal tax return is a document filed annually with the IRS that reports your company’s income, expenses, and other pertinent tax information. It is crucial for legal compliance, ensuring your business pays the correct amount of taxes.
It also helps maintain good financial records and can be important for securing business loans or investments.
What are the deadlines for filing federal tax returns for businesses?
Deadlines vary depending on the business structure. Generally, corporations and individuals must file by April 15, while partnerships and S-corporations are required to submit their tax returns by March 15. However, if these dates fall on a weekend or holiday, the deadline is the next business day.
Extensions are available but must be requested before the original due date.

Are there any special tax considerations for international entrepreneurs operating in the U.S.?
Yes, international entrepreneurs may be eligible for certain tax treaties, exemptions, or credits based on bilateral agreements between the U.S. and their home country.
Additionally, issues like double taxation, transfer pricing, and reporting of foreign assets are important and should be considered case-by-case.
